Handover for tonight's on-call (Quillstore profile service): the resharding job moved shards 4–9 to the new Kestrel cluster this afternoon. Replication lag is settling but watch the lag dashboard until midnight. If the router misroutes reads, flip the topology flag back via the shard-admin console. Console access requires unlocking the admin keyring with the recovery passphrase below.

unlock words, kajef-kadug: sorys-pelax-lamael-tamvan-briiel-novdor-fenwyn-tamdor-oliion-keleth-julok-belion-ralok

## Deployment

ProctorLine's exam queue deploys as a single service behind the Wrenmoor gateway. Support team: you only need this when restarting a stuck queue. Deploys are blue/green; sessions in progress drain before the old instance stops, so never force-kill during an exam window. Restarts take about two minutes. After restart, confirm the service came up with the expected settings, listed below.

config for kajog-tadug:
[casax]
port = 11211
region = west-3
host = casax.nelvroworks.internal
timeout_ms = 5000
retries = 7

# ValiKit Plugin Limits

ValiKit loads third-party validator plugins per tenant. Quotas are enforced at load time; breaches surface as `PLUGIN_QUOTA` errors in the tenant log. Support cannot override these without an engineering ticket. Plugins exceeding memory or timeout limits are disabled automatically until re-enabled. The enforced constants are listed below.

tuning table, kajog-bawip:
TIERS = {
    "kelius": 256,
    "lammir": 543,
}

**Ticket QB-2214: Expired creds blocking Relaymill 4.x upgrade**

Plugin authors: the broker upgrade to Relaymill 4.x invalidated all pre-migration tokens. Plugins pinned to the old auth endpoint will fail handshake after Friday. Update your manifest to target the `broker-v4` scope and rebuild. Sandbox testing is open now. Use the replacement key issued below.

gateway credential: kto3_qfe